Latest Patents
Ehlers' most recent inventions include two notable patents that advance the performance of automotive vehicles. The first patent describes a unique method of adjusting idle spark for individual cylinders in internal combustion engines. This method incorporates steps for determining crankshaft acceleration, average acceleration errors, and subsequently adjusting the spark advance for improved engine performance. The second patent focuses on a method for pulse width modulating an oxygen sensor's resistance element. This innovation allows for quick heating of the oxygen sensor and efficient operation across varying temperature ranges, ultimately enhancing vehicle emissions control.
